1111622281 has 27 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 1424644263. Its totient is φ = 864198720.
The previous prime is 1111622257. The next prime is 1111622297. The reversal of 1111622281 is 1822261111.
The square root of 1111622281 is 33341.
It is a perfect power (a square), and thus also a powerful number.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 124657225 + 986965056 = 11165^2 + 31416^2 .
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1111622281 - 25 = 1111622249 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×11116222812 = 2471408191231285922, which contains 22 as substring.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(1111622201)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 26 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2567041 + ... + 2567473.
Almost surely, 21111622281 is an apocalyptic number.
1111622281 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(11) formed by its first and last digit.
1111622281 is the 33341-st square number.
1111622281 is the 16671-st centered octagonal number.
It is an amenable number.
1111622281 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(313021982).
1111622281 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
1111622281 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 902 (or 451 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 384, while the sum is 25.
The cubic root of 1111622281 is about 1035.9029766699.
Multiplying 1111622281 by its sum of digits (25), we get a square (27790557025 = 1667052).
Adding to 1111622281 its reverse (1822261111), we get a palindrome (2933883392).
The spelling of 1111622281 in words is "one billion, one hundred eleven million, six hundred twenty-two thousand, two hundred eighty-one".
